Have you noticed that all the changes in the governments economic statistics serve to support the new era beliefs. One of the most blatant examples in the implementation of chained dollar GDP. The government decides that because computer prices have fallen but performance has improved that the real dollars exchanged understate the real growth of the economy. What really matters though are real dollars that change hands PC makers report their results in real dollars not chained dollars. No other government in the world uses this method.
